Created in 2009, Blue Line Sterilization Services has been committed to reducing the time to market for innovators designing new medical devices. The company differentiates itself by maintaining a bank of 8 cubic foot ethylene oxide (EO) sterilizers, providing FDA and EU compliant sterilization with turnaround times of 1 to 3 days—an achievement impractical with larger EO sterilization services.

Co-founders Brant and Jane Gard acknowledged the vital need for accelerated sterilization options, particularly for highly active development programs creating innovative medical devices. The ability to swiftly navigate through device iterations is crucial in reducing the need for additional funding, preserving the value of investors' equity, and expediting time to market. Faster service and reduced time to market hold considerable value for employees, investors, and the patients benefiting from improved medical care.

Complementing routine sterilization, Blue Line offers rapid turnkey validations and small batch releases that support clinical trials and FDA/CE submissions. Why Medical Device Sterilization Matters

Preventing infections remains a critical foundation of modern medicine.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) estimate that around 1 in 31 hospital patients experiences at least one healthcare-associated infection (HAI). thorough sterilization of medical devices greatly reduces the risk of these infections, safeguarding patients and healthcare providers equally. Improper sterilization can bring about outbreaks of life-threatening diseases like hepatitis, HIV, and antibiotic-resistant bacterial infections.

Techniques for Sterilizing Medical Instruments

The science behind sterilization has developed extensively over the last century, applying a variety of methods suited to distinct types of devices and materials. Some of the most predominantly chosen techniques include:

Steam Sterilization (Autoclaving)

Autoclaving remains the most widespread and trusted method of sterilization, particularly suitable for surgical instruments and reusable metal devices. Using high-pressure saturated steam at temperatures around 121–134°C, autoclaving effectively kills bacteria, viruses, fungi, and spores. This method is speedy, cost-efficient, and ecologically sound, although not suitable for heat-sensitive materials.

Green Sterilization Methods

As ecological guidelines increase, companies are actively seeking green sterilization options. Strategies include reducing reliance on toxic chemicals like ethylene oxide, exploring reusable packaging materials, and optimizing electricity use in sterilization processes.

Intricate Materials and Device Complexity

The rise of high-tech medical devices—such as robotic surgery instruments and intricate diagnostic equipment—demands sterilization methods capable of handling elaborate materials. Improvements in sterilization include methods namely low-temperature plasma sterilization and hydrogen peroxide vapor, which can sterilize without damaging complex components.

Digital Documentation and Compliance

With advances in digital technology, monitoring of sterilization operations is now more precise than ever. Digital traceability systems offer extensive documentation, automated compliance checks, and real-time prompts, significantly minimizing human error and boosting patient safety.
